XRP Inflation Analysis · September 2026 · Supply growing, projected to keep growing
XRP has no protocol inflation at all — every one of the 100B XRP was created in the XRP Ledger's genesis ledger, and the network has no operation that issues more. The pressure comes from Ripple's escrow instead: 1.00B XRP unlocks on the first of each month, but reading the escrow contracts directly shows the locked balance falling only from 32.60B to 31.70B across this window, so the realised release was 900M XRP, not the 3.00B the calendar promised. Against a fee burn of just 30.0K XRP, the MrNasdog Pressure Framework reads XRP at +1.43% net over the last 90 days versus a supply-monitor reading of +0.66% — a gap of 0.78 percentage points, which ships with a monitor-gap flag. XRP is non-inflationary by protocol and schedule-inflationary on the float.
The verdict, in one paragraph
For the 90-day window ending Sep 9 2026, the Pressure Framework reads XRP at +1.43% net. The sell side is the Ripple escrow release, measured on-chain as a realised outflow rather than as a calendar entitlement: the locked XRP escrow balance fell by 900M XRP across the window, even though 3.00B XRP unlocked on paper across three monthly firings and 2.10B XRP went straight back into fresh escrow contracts. The buy side is a mere 30.0K XRP of transaction-fee burn — real, permanent, and a few thousandths of one percent of the release. The independent supply monitor reads +0.66% over the same window, so the gap is 0.78 percentage points and sits outside the framework's half-point tolerance; the page therefore carries a monitor-gap flag, and the primary on-chain reading is the one that ships. XRP is best described as non-inflationary by protocol but schedule-inflationary on the active float — the total supply of XRP can never grow, yet the monthly escrow unlock keeps expanding the tradable share of a fixed pie.
Sell pressure: where new XRP comes from
Sell #1 — protocol inflation — is zero, and it is zero for a reason no vote can undo. The XRP Ledger has no minting operation in its transaction set. The entire 100B XRP supply was created in a single genesis ledger, and every read of the ledger's total-supply field since has been lower than the one before it. Two direct on-chain reads bracket this window: 99,985,648,777 XRP at the start and 99,985,618,817 XRP at the end, reproduced exactly on a second, independent public node. XRP supply fell. That falling read is also what proves the field is a live measurement rather than a hardcoded constant — a flat number would have proved nothing. There is no emission curve, no block reward, no staking issuance and no inflation parameter to tune.
Sell #2 — vesting unlocks — is the whole XRP supply story, and it is where the published schedule and the tradable float pull apart. Ripple wrote 55B XRP into dated on-ledger escrow contracts in 2017, and 1.00B XRP expires out of escrow on the first of each month. Three such unlocks fell inside this window, on Jul 1 2026, Aug 1 2026 and Sep 1 2026, which is 3.00B XRP of calendar entitlement. The escrow contracts are readable on-chain, and reading them settles it: total escrowed XRP was 32.60B at the start of the window and 31.70B at the end. Ripple locked 2.10B XRP straight back into fresh escrow contracts. The realised release — the number the Pressure Framework ships — is therefore 900M XRP, or roughly 300M XRP a month. Booking the gross 3.00B would have invented 2.1B of XRP sell pressure that never touched a market.
The two legs are one operation, not two, and the framework counts them once. The escrow balance cannot fall without the monthly release, and the re-lock is funded out of that same release, so treating the unlock as sell pressure and the re-lock as buy pressure would double-count a single monthly event on both sides of the ledger. The arithmetic closes with nothing left over: 3.00B XRP of escrow finished, 2.10B XRP of escrow created, and a measured escrow balance 900M XRP lower — the sweep and the independent balance read agree to zero. Ripple's own published distribution figure for the start of the window, 32.60B XRP escrowed, matches the on-ledger enumeration exactly.
Sell #3 — Foundation and unscheduled unlocks — is zero for this window, on measurement rather than on assumption. Ripple's identified non-escrow XRP wallets held 3.68B XRP at the start and 3.78B XRP at the end — a net inflow of about 106M XRP, so those wallets absorbed part of the escrow release rather than draining into a market. That leg of the sweep is partial by construction, since Ripple's own classification of non-escrow company holdings runs larger than the wallets that can be identified by label, so it is used to establish direction and never as a row value; the complete leg is the escrow one. Sell #4 — long-term locked or bankruptcy supply — is zero too: no estate holds XRP on a trustee schedule and no long-dated XRP lock is unwinding.
Buy pressure: where new XRP goes
Buy #1 — programmatic buyback — is zero. Nothing buys XRP back. The $750M repurchase Ripple announced in March 2026 bought the company's own private shares at a $50B valuation, not the coin, and it closed in April, before this window opened. Buy #3 — foundation buying — is zero for the same structural reason: Ripple is a seller of XRP into its own operations, never an accumulator, and no on-chain flow this window shows XRP being bought.
Buy #2 — the protocol fee burn — is the only thing on the XRP buy side, and it removed 30.0K XRP across the window, about 334 XRP a day. The XRP Ledger destroys every transaction fee outright rather than paying it to a validator, which is why the chain has no block reward and no dead address to watch: the coins leave the supply meter, and the four unspendable accounts on the ledger moved less than 1 XRP in ninety days between them. Reading both surfaces is what caught this — the dead-address surface says nothing happened, the supply surface says 30.0K XRP is gone, and the disagreement is the finding. The burn was closed against the transaction log twice: across two separate slices of the chain, the sum of every fee paid equalled the fall in total supply to the drop, with a residual of zero. All-time, that mechanism has destroyed 14.38M XRP since launch — under 0.015% of genesis, and against a 900M release it is a rounding error. Buy #4 — new long-term locks — is zero, because the 2.10B XRP re-escrowed this window is already netted inside the Sell #2 figure.
Foundation and overhang
XRP has the largest single tracked overhang in the framework, and it is fully readable. The Ripple escrow now holds 31.70B XRP, just over half of the circulating float, spread across eight on-ledger accounts and released on a published monthly rule with roughly seventy percent locked straight back. Alongside it sit Ripple's identified non-escrow wallets at 3.78B XRP, which grew rather than drained this window. Both balances are re-read on every refresh rather than taken on trust. Exchange custody wallets, the seven US spot XRP funds and unlabelled large holders are excluded by rule — those XRP belong to depositors, to fund shareholders, or to no identified group. If the escrow balance falls faster than the monthly rule implies, or if the non-escrow wallets drain between refreshes, the extra outflow enters Sell #3 at the next refresh.
How XRP compares to other payment-rail chains
XRP sits in an unusual structural position: a hard-capped, zero-issuance asset that nevertheless prints a positive inflation reading. A proof-of-work chain with a hard cap still pays a block subsidy, so its supply rises toward the ceiling while its float and its supply move together. An uncapped proof-of-stake Layer 1 mints validator rewards continuously and hopes a fee burn offsets them. XRP does neither — it mints nothing at all, and its total supply falls by a few hundred XRP a day. What grows is the tradable share of a fixed 100B, released from escrow on a calendar. That is a genuinely different mechanism from issuance, and it has a definite end: at roughly 300M XRP a month of realised release, the 31.70B XRP still escrowed is about nine years of drip before the schedule runs out and the sell side goes permanently to zero.
Against the exchange-linked chain tokens the framework also tracks, the contrast is in what funds the buy side. A chain that routes a slice of every gas fee into destruction shrinks its float continuously, and a chain that burns a reserve on a quarterly schedule shrinks it in steps. The XRP Ledger does neither at scale, because its fee is priced as an anti-spam floor of a hundredth of a US cent rather than as revenue: a day of several million XRP transactions destroys a few hundred XRP. The fee economy on the XRP Ledger runs at roughly $175,000 a year against a market capitalisation near $89B — several orders of magnitude below the smart-contract chains whose burns actually move their float. That design choice is deliberate and it makes XRP cheap to use; the trade-off is that nothing on the XRP buy side can offset the escrow drip, so the sell side sets the reading on its own.
What to watch in the next 90 days
First, the three monthly escrow unlocks on Oct 1 2026, Nov 1 2026 and Dec 1 2026: each releases 1.00B XRP gross, and the whole forward reading turns on the re-lock ratio holding near seventy percent — a month with no re-escrow would triple the realised release. Second, the listed XRP treasury vehicle whose shareholder vote lands on Sep 30 2026, targeting a launch balance of at least 473M XRP; open-market buying by that vehicle moves existing float between holders, but the Ripple contribution disclosed in its filing lands only on closing and would be new float, entering Sell #3 if it fires. Third, a regulatory filing this summer flagged that Ripple could release XRP from escrow beyond the monthly rule if pending US market-structure legislation passes — the single biggest tail risk on this page, and the one event that would break the 300M-a-month pace. Fourth, the quantum-resistance upgrade whose validator activation window opened on Aug 28 2026 and could take effect from Sep 11 2026: it changes signatures, not issuance, so the forward reading was left alone.
Summary
The MrNasdog Pressure Framework reads XRP at +1.43% net over the trailing 90 days and +1.43% over the next 90, on a sell side made entirely of one row. The structural mechanism is a chain that mints nothing — the full 100B XRP existed at genesis and total supply only falls — combined with a monthly escrow release whose realised outflow was 900M XRP against a 3.00B XRP calendar entitlement, and a fee burn of 30.0K XRP far too small to offset it. The key risk is that the re-escrow is discretionary rather than contractual: Ripple chooses how much to lock back each month, so a decision to stop would triple the sell side overnight without any change to the published schedule. The ceiling is the escrow itself — 31.70B XRPstill locked, roughly nine years of drip at the current realised pace, after which XRP's sell side is permanently empty.
